Ikaria Greece is particularly famous for one thing: the longevity of the islanders! The inhabitants of Ikaria live for many many years thanks to the nutritious Ikarian diet, walking, stress-free everyday life, and optimism! You can have a taste of all these qualities, along with the excellent local wine, at the regular traditional village feasts that are organized every summer in Ikaria.
As for Ikaria beaches, they boast the most beautiful wild natural landscapes! Visit Seychelles Ikaria beach, Mesakti, Nas and Livadi beaches to live your best beach life! For those who want to combine their beach day with island exploration, their best bet is trekking through Halari gorge, which leads to the beautiful Nas beach, one of the best places to marvel at the Aegean sunset from!
Once (or if) you manage to peel yourself away from the beautiful beaches, head to the little gems of the island: the picturesque Ikaria villages! Visit Armenistis Ikaria, Manganitis and Karkinagri to immerse yourself in the island’s culture. Ikaria villages are the best places to observe the everyday life of the islanders firsthand, learn their longevity secrets, taste the excellent local wine and gorge on homemade delicacies!
